The XRP community has been excited over the recent re-listing of XRP as a tradable asset on the Robinhood investment platform.

Cryptocurrency exchange platform Robinhood has quietly re-listed XRP as a tradable asset on its platform, much to the excitement of the XRP community.
Recall that Robinhood distanced itself from the crypto asset over a year ago amid the Ripple vs SEC battle before the regulatory clarity of the asset was declared. Even though other top exchanges like Coinbase and Kraken re-listed the coin following a partial victory in 2023, Robinhood remained persistent in supporting XRP.
However, all that has changed as the popular exchange platform has added the Ripple-backed coin to its list of tradeable assets. This comes on the heels of the official conclusion of the court battle between the blockchain giant and the Securities and Exchange Commission.
XRP Re-Appears on the Robinhood Website
Even though the company has not officially announced the update, users quickly noticed an inclusion in the website’s ‘About‘ page. The page has a list of supported cryptocurrencies that users can trade on the platform including Aave (AAVE), Bitcoin (BTC), Bitcoin Cash (BCH), Dogecoin (DOGE), Ethereum (ETH), Ethereum Classic (ETC), Polygon (POL), SHIB, PEPE, now including XRP, and others.

This update has created excitement and ignited optimism among investors who now eye possible new price levels since their beloved coin will be exposed to an even larger audience who will be confident in investing following its new legal clarity.
However, the platform also noted on its updated page that the cryptocurrency services are only available to users in the European Union. “Cryptocurrency services are offered for eligible EU customers through an account with Robinhood Europe, UAB,” it says.
Meanwhile, there had been expectations for Robinhood to list XRP, especially following its acquisition of the Bitstamp exchange. Bitstamp supports XRP trading and has been one of the major destinations of significant XRP dumps since the beginning of the year. However, the prolonged legal tussle between Ripple and the SEC became a hindrance for an earlier listing, but all that has now passed as Ripple is expected to pay the $125 million civil penalty imposed by Judge Torres for violating securities laws.
